Transaction 66c22521fb9a27236ed087a52f92ea306b0ce3407be60b3bab0a510881c23bdd
1 Input
1 Output
-
66c22521fb9a27236ed087a52f92ea306b0ce3407be60b3bab0a510881c23bdd:0
- value
- 4250288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0cf8331b780bc1dc8d89c038968cdf0e21ec12e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FfHhuvs1EL3VGKJRRHEdsHKdz3KWVe29K